-
- Ecshop源码中缓存机制的实现方式
- Ecshop使用文件缓存和数据库缓存两种方式实现缓存机制。1.文件缓存通过cls_cache类将数据序列化存储在服务器文件系统中,读取速度快但不适合分布式环境。2.数据库缓存使用ecs_cache表存储数据,适用于分布式环境但性能较低。选择缓存方式需根据具体应用场景和性能需求。
- ECShop . CMS教程 263 2025-06-07 15:36:01
-
- 解决Ecshop数据库配置文件连接错误的方法
- Ecshop数据库配置文件连接错误可以通过以下步骤解决:1.检查config.php文件中的$db_host、$db_user、$db_pass、$db_name和$db_prefix参数是否正确。2.确保MySQL服务器运行正常且$db_user有足够权限。3.检查网络连接和防火墙设置。4.确认字符集设置为UTF-8。5.查看日志文件查找详细错误信息。
- ECShop . CMS教程 799 2025-06-06 15:45:01
-
- Ecshop二次开发定制商品推荐算法的实践
- 可以通过Ecshop二次开发定制商品推荐算法。首先,了解Ecshop的架构和数据模型;其次,结合用户行为和商品信息,构建混合推荐算法;最后,关注数据质量、算法性能和隐私保护,并利用插件系统进行快速迭代和测试。
- ECShop . CMS教程 320 2025-06-05 08:33:08
-
- Ecshop二次开发优化订单处理流程的方法
- 在不破坏Ecshop原有系统稳定性的前提下,可以通过以下步骤提高订单处理效率:1.自动化订单状态变化,通过自定义插件实现订单状态自动更新并发送通知;2.优化订单查询和统计,使用索引和自定义报表提升查询效率;3.简化后台操作流程,设计一键处理和拖拽改变订单状态的功能。
- ECShop . CMS教程 1028 2025-06-04 17:09:01
-
- 如何从官方渠道获取纯净的Ecshop商城源码
- 要获取纯净的Ecshop商城源码,最直接且安全的方式是从官方渠道下载。1.从Ecshop官方网站下载源码,确保代码的完整性和安全性。2.下载后进行MD5校验码对比,验证文件未被篡改。3.熟悉源码目录结构,Ecshop的核心文件主要在includes和admin目录。4.安装时注意权限问题,可能需要手动调整或联系主机提供商。
- ECShop . CMS教程 562 2025-06-03 08:00:02
-
- Ecshop二次开发实现会员等级特权的详细步骤
- 要在Ecshop实现会员等级特权,需要修改user_rank表并在相关PHP代码中加入判断逻辑。具体步骤包括:1.在user_rank表中增加privilege字段。2.为特定会员等级设置特权。3.在订单处理逻辑中加入根据会员等级应用折扣的代码。
- ECShop . CMS教程 477 2025-06-02 10:17:14
-
- Ecshop二次开发实现商品预售功能的流程
- 实现商品预售功能需要通过自定义开发在Ecshop中添加新逻辑和界面。具体步骤包括:1.在数据库中添加is_presale、presale_start_time和presale_end_time字段;2.扩展后台管理界面,添加预售相关选项;3.修改前端展示逻辑,添加预售标签和说明;4.调整订单处理逻辑,确保预售期间只能生成预售订单。
- ECShop . CMS教程 283 2025-05-31 08:18:01
-
- Ecshop二次开发实现商品团购功能的详细流程
- 实现Ecshop二次开发商品团购功能的详细流程包括:1.分析需求并设计团构架;2.修改数据库结构以支持团购数据;3.在前端和后台开发团购页面和逻辑;4.进行测试和优化。通过这些步骤,我们不仅增强了Ecshop的功能,还提升了用户的购物体验。
- ECShop . CMS教程 849 2025-05-30 10:18:01
-
- 备份和恢复Ecshop数据库配置文件的操作步骤
- 备份和恢复Ecshop数据库配置文件的步骤包括:1.使用命令行工具备份数据库,命令为“mysqldump-u用户名-p数据库名>/path/to/backup/backup.sql”,并检查备份文件完整性;2.在恢复前备份现有数据,并在测试环境中先行恢复,命令为“mysql-u用户名-p数据库名$BACKUP_DIR/$DB_NAME-$TIMESTAMP.sql”;4.在业务低峰期进行恢复操作,并考虑使用高可用方案以减少对用户的影响,注意数据库结构的一致性。
- ECShop . CMS教程 805 2025-05-29 14:00:03
-
- Ecshop二次开发添加优惠券系统的代码实现
- 在Ecshop二次开发中可以添加优惠券系统。具体步骤包括:1.创建ecs_coupons表存储优惠券信息;2.在flow.php中添加优惠券使用逻辑,计算优惠金额并更新使用数量;3.考虑优惠券发放方式、使用限制和叠加规则;4.注意有效期、库存和并发使用管理;5.进行性能优化,如缓存、异步处理和索引优化。通过这些步骤,可以提升用户体验和商家营销效果。
- ECShop . CMS教程 361 2025-05-28 14:06:01
-
- ECShop 如何设置限时折扣活动?
- 在ECShop中设置限时折扣活动可以通过后台的促销管理功能实现。具体步骤包括:1.进入后台管理界面,选择“促销管理”菜单,点击“限时折扣”选项。2.设置活动时间,建议在用户活跃的周末或节假日,活动时长3到7天。3.确定折扣力度,根据商品利润和市场竞争情况,一般可设30%折扣。4.选择热销或库存积压的商品参与活动,用户评价高的商品效果更好。5.通过邮件、社交媒体等多渠道宣传活动,并确保商品库存充足,优化活动页面用户体验。
- ECShop . CMS教程 451 2025-05-27 17:33:01
-
- Ecshop二次开发增强会员积分系统功能的步骤
- 要增强Ecshop的会员积分系统,需从以下几个方面入手:1.修改积分规则,增加签到、分享、评论等获取途径,修改includes/lib_main.php文件;2.增强积分使用方式,增加兑换礼品和抽奖功能,需在user.php中添加新页面和逻辑;3.增加积分有效期和等级制度,需修改数据库结构和业务逻辑,确保前台清晰展示规则。
- ECShop . CMS教程 504 2025-05-26 12:09:02
-
- Ecshop二次开发添加商品评论和打分功能的教程
- 我们添加商品评论和打分功能的原因是增强用户体验、帮助潜在买家决策、增加商品信任度和透明度。实现这一功能涉及数据库设计、前端展示、后台管理和用户交互等多个方面:1.设计数据库结构,如创建ecs_rating表存储评分和评论数据;2.修改前端页面展示评分和评论;3.添加表单让用户提交评论和打分;4.处理用户提交的数据并存储到数据库;5.在后台管理系统中添加模块管理评论和评分。
- ECShop . CMS教程 896 2025-05-24 10:06:01
-
- 分析Ecshop源码中数据库操作的代码逻辑
- Ecshop的数据库操作通过自定义的抽象层$GLOBALS['ecs']->db进行,封装了MySQL操作方法,如query、getOne等,并支持事务和SQL注入防护。1.使用$GLOBALS['ecs']->db对象进行数据库操作,封装了MySQL基本操作方法。2.支持事务处理,确保数据一致性,如订单处理中的原子操作。3.实施严格的SQL注入防护,通过过滤和转义用户输入。Ecshop的设计简化了开发过程,但需要注意性能损失和升级兼容性问题。
- ECShop . CMS教程 861 2025-05-23 08:36:01
-
- ECShop 商品评论审核机制如何优化?
- ECShop的商品评论审核机制可以通过引入自动化审核、用户信誉系统、评论标签系统和实时监控来优化。1.自动化审核利用机器学习和自然语言处理技术快速识别敏感内容。2.用户信誉系统根据用户历史评论和购买行为评估评论可信度。3.评论标签系统通过用户投票识别高质量评论。4.实时监控和反馈机制及时处理违规评论并提供举报渠道。
- ECShop . CMS教程 831 2025-05-22 12:06:01

P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是